An animal gets energy from the food it eats, especially carbohydrates and proteins. This food is broken down in the stomach and the nutrients are absorbed through the stomach wall into the blood stream and blood cells.

Muscle cells often contain many mitochondria because muscle cells often require a lot of energy, and since mitochondria create ATP which is the form of energy used by our bodies, it is essential to have many of them in cells that constantly require more energy than, as an example, skin cells.
